powered by simpleCommunicator - 2.0.53     © 2025 Programmizd 02
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Регулярные выражения
7 сообщений из 7, страница 1 из 1
Регулярные выражения
    #39981222
Jack963
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Чем в PostgreSQL можно заменить REGEXP_COUNT?
--если повторяющаяся фраза,то записываем в новую таблицу
if str(i)=str(g) and red2(i)<red1(g) then
str2(t):=str(i);
quantity(t):=REGEXP_COUNT(str2(t),'[^[:space:]]? [^[:space:]]');--находим кол-во слов во фразе
...
Рейтинг: 0 / 0
Регулярные выражения
    #39981240
Jack963
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
как удалить все лишние пробелы в PL/pgSQL?
На вход поступает строка'vfvf vfvf qwr'
нужно сделать'vfvf vfvf qwr'
...
Рейтинг: 0 / 0
Регулярные выражения
    #39981246
Ролг Хупин
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Правильный подход, каждый вопрос лучше задавать в отдельной теме, но название должно быть обобщенным
...
Рейтинг: 0 / 0
Регулярные выражения
    #39981247
Ролг Хупин
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Jack963
как удалить все лишние пробелы в PL/pgSQL?
На вход поступает строка'vfvf vfvf qwr'
нужно сделать'vfvf vfvf qwr'


Что такое "все лишние"?

PS. Правильный подход, каждый вопрос лучше задавать в отдельной теме, но название должно быть обобщенным
...
Рейтинг: 0 / 0
Регулярные выражения
    #39981249
Павел Лузанов
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Jack963,

Чтобы разобраться как работать со строками в PostgreSQL стоит изучить строковые функции и поиск по шаблону .
...
Рейтинг: 0 / 0
Регулярные выражения
    #39981434
Swa111
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Jack963,

не очень понятно чем строки в Вашем примере отличаются. Если предполагалось что заменить несколько пробелов на один то примерно так. regexp_replace
Код: plsql
1.
regexp_replace(sMyStr, '\s+', ' ', 'g')
...
Рейтинг: 0 / 0
Регулярные выражения
    #39981680
Ролг Хупин
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Swa111
Jack963,

не очень понятно чем строки в Вашем примере отличаются. Если предполагалось что заменить несколько пробелов на один то примерно так. regexp_replace
Код: plsql
1.
regexp_replace(sMyStr, '\s+', ' ', 'g')



он мог пропустить этот вопрос, ветки две, он вторую мониторит
...
Рейтинг: 0 / 0
7 сообщений из 7,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Регулярные выражения
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]